Prvit Salary

As of August 2026, the average annual salary for employees at Prvit in the United States is $94,658.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$46. Salaries at Prvit typically range from $83,196 to $107,087 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

About Prvit
We are a minority-based marketing organization. Our network consists of young influential minority professionals. We are executives, lawyers, doctors, architects, politicians, artists/creatives, and entrepreneurs. We have a network of 17,000+ subscribers and 1,500+ PRVIT Members.We curate impactful experiences that connect companies to lifestyles and culture through strategic execution.We encourag
